1. Personalized Customer Experiences

Customers want personalized experiences that resonate with their individual needs. Telecom companies need to understand the preferences, behaviors, and pain points of their target audience. Personalization in marketing can drastically improve customer engagement and satisfaction, leading to higher conversion rates.

How to Implement Personalized Customer Experiences:

  • Data-Driven Insights: Use customer data to analyze buying behaviors, service preferences, and engagement history. Tools like CRM systems and AI-driven analytics platforms can provide valuable insights that help you segment your audience more effectively.
  • Tailored Messaging: Customize your communication to speak directly to your customers’ needs. Whether it’s a promotional email, a targeted ad, or a phone call, ensure that your messaging aligns with the customer’s profile, location, and usage patterns.
  • Dynamic Pricing and Offers: Telecom companies can offer special pricing or bundled services based on customer usage patterns or loyalty, making the offer feel more relevant and compelling.

By providing a personalized experience, telecom brands can improve customer acquisition and retention. For example, a targeted offer for a 5G plan can appeal to tech-savvy customers, while discounts on data packages might attract budget-conscious consumers.

2. Referral Programs

Referral programs have been one of the most effective ways to generate leads and acquire customers for telecom brands. People trust the opinions of their friends and family more than any marketing message. By encouraging existing customers to refer others, you can tap into their network and exponentially increase your customer base.

How to Implement Referral Programs:

  • Incentivize Referrals: Offer rewards such as discounts, free service upgrades, or cash bonuses for every successful referral. Make sure the incentives are attractive enough to motivate both the referrer and the referred.
  • Easy-to-Use Platforms: Create a seamless referral process, such as sending a referral link through text or email. The easier you make it for customers to refer others, the more likely they will participate.
  • Track and Reward: Implement a system that tracks referral success and ensures both the referrer and referee get their rewards promptly. This system can be managed through your CRM or marketing automation platform.

Referral programs are a highly cost-effective way to drive customer acquisition for telecom brands. Since referred customers are more likely to trust your company, the quality of leads generated through referrals is typically higher, and conversion rates are often better.

3. Search Engine Optimization (SEO) for Telecom

Search Engine Optimization is one of the most effective long-term marketing strategies to boost visibility and attract potential customers. For telecom companies, ranking high for industry-specific keywords like “best mobile plans” or “fiber optic internet services” can generate organic leads and increase web traffic.

How to Optimize Your Telecom Website for SEO:

  • Keyword Research: Conduct in-depth keyword research to identify high-traffic, low-competition keywords relevant to telecom services. Use these keywords strategically in your website content, blog posts, and landing pages.
  • Local SEO: Since many telecom services are region-specific, optimize your website for local search terms such as “telecom services in [city]” or “best internet plans near me.” Ensure that your business is listed on Google My Business for better local visibility.
  • On-Page Optimization: Include keywords in your meta titles, meta descriptions, header tags, and throughout the page content. Use high-quality images and ensure fast loading times to improve user experience.
  • Content Marketing: Regularly publish blog posts, FAQs, and case studies that address common questions or problems your target audience faces. This can establish your telecom brand as a trusted authority in the industry and further improve SEO rankings.

By focusing on SEO, telecom brands can increase organic traffic, build credibility, and generate high-quality leads over time. Additionally, SEO provides a solid foundation for other marketing efforts, such as paid ads and content marketing campaigns.

4. Pay-Per-Click Advertising (PPC)

While SEO is a long-term investment, PPC advertising can produce immediate results for customer acquisition. Google Ads, Bing Ads, and social media ads are effective platforms for telecom brands to target specific keywords, demographics, and geographic locations to generate qualified leads.

How to Use PPC for Telecom Lead Generation:

  • Targeted Keywords: Just like in SEO, start with thorough keyword research. Choose high-converting keywords that are specific to your services, such as “affordable internet plans” or “best 5G mobile plan.”
  • Landing Page Optimization: When users click on your ads, make sure they land on a highly optimized, relevant landing page that drives conversions. The landing page should match the ad’s message and offer a clear call to action (CTA), such as signing up for a free trial or purchasing a service plan.
  • Geo-Targeting: Use geo-targeting to reach specific geographic areas where you want to promote certain services. For example, if you’re offering fiber internet in a new city, target that area with localized ads.
  • Retargeting: Implement retargeting ads to reach users who have previously visited your website but did not convert. Retargeting helps bring potential customers back and nudges them toward making a decision.

PPC is an excellent method of lead generation for telecom companies that need quick results. It’s a scalable and measurable approach, allowing you to adjust your campaigns based on performance and budget.

5. Social Media Marketing

Social media platforms are powerful tools for engaging with customers, building brand awareness, and generating leads. Telecom companies can use social media to share valuable content, showcase customer testimonials, promote special offers, and even run contests or giveaways to engage with potential customers.

How to Maximize Social Media Marketing for Telecom:

  • Platform Selection: Focus on the platforms where your target audience is most active. For example, LinkedIn might be ideal for B2B telecom services, while Instagram and Facebook are great for consumer-focused campaigns.
  • Engaging Content: Share relevant content that resonates with your audience. This could be tips for managing data usage, announcements about new service offerings, or user-generated content showcasing customer satisfaction.
  • Interactive Campaigns: Run interactive campaigns such as polls, Q&A sessions, or giveaways. These activities can help boost engagement and raise brand awareness while attracting new leads.
  • Paid Social Ads: In addition to organic posts, use paid ads to target users based on demographics, interests, and behaviors.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n provide robust ad targeting options that can help you reach the right customers at the right time.

Social media marketing can help foster a community of loyal users who can advocate for your brand. As telecom brands have many touchpoints with customers, social media becomes a great way to nurture relationships and maintain ongoing engagement.

6. Influencer Partnerships

Influencer marketing is a growing trend that can provide a massive boost to telecom companies’ marketing efforts. Influencers can help promote your products or services to a broad audience in a more authentic and engaging manner.

How to Leverage Influencer Marketing for Telecom:

  • Identify Relevant Influencers: Look for influencers who align with your brand values and have a following that matches your target audience. For example, tech bloggers, YouTubers, or social media influencers specializing in technology and gadgets can effectively promote telecom products.
  • Collaborate on Content: Work with influencers to create sponsored content, product reviews, or unboxing videos that showcase your telecom services. This kind of authentic promotion helps potential customers trust your brand and increases the likelihood of conversion.
  • Track ROI: Just like any other marketing strategy, ensure that you track the performance of your influencer campaigns. Use affiliate links or unique discount codes to measure the impact and calculate ROI.

Influencer marketing is a fantastic way to reach younger or niche demographics, such as tech enthusiasts or millennials, who may not respond to traditional advertising channels. By partnering with influencers who have a loyal following, telecom companies can drive high-quality leads and improve brand perception.

7. Customer Service as a Marketing Tool

Customer service is often a key differentiator in every market. Excellent customer service can not only help retain existing customers but also act as a powerful marketing tool that attracts new customers.

How to Use Customer Service to Drive Acquisition:

  • Live Chat and Chatbots: Offering immediate assistance through live chat or AI-powered chatbots can improve the user experience and guide potential customers through the decision-making process.
  • Proactive Communication: Use customer service teams to proactively reach out to prospects, answer questions, and address concerns. This helps build trust early in the buying process.
  • Post-Sale Support: Follow up with new customers after they’ve signed up for a service to ensure their experience is positive. This helps build strong relationships and can turn customers into advocates who spread the word about your brand.

Outstanding customer service can also act as a form of marketing through word-of-mouth recommendations. Happy customers are more likely to refer friends and family, helping generate leads for your telecom company.
